PrtSc key also places a copy in the Trainz Screenshots folder so you don't have to use the paste into a graphics program. This also allows multiple screen shots to be saved in a session.
Once you have taken up to 999 screen shot's of your route/layout, etc, etc, you will need to convert your images from their existing larger file format to a much smaller format like "JPG - JPEG" images... (basically this reduces the individual screen shotfile size to a far smaller file size).
Download and install; - http://www.irfanview.com/main_download_engl.htm
Then convert your images to "JPEG" images. - Hope this helps...
